Household and similar electrical appliances - Safety - Part 2-113: Particular requirements for beauty care appliances incorporating lasers and intense light sources

This European Standard deals with the safety of cosmetic and beauty care appliances incorporating lasers or intense light sources for household and similar purposes, where their operation relies on contact with the skin, their rated voltage being not more than 250 V

SIST EN IEC 60335-2-113:2023/oprA1:2026 is classified under the following ICS (International Classification for Standards) categories: 13.120 - Domestic safety; 97.170 - Body care equipment. The ICS classification helps identify the subject area and facilitates finding related standards.

SIST EN IEC 60335-2-113:2023/oprA1:2026 has the following relationships with other standards: It is inter standard links to SIST EN IEC 60335-2-113:2023, SIST EN IEC 60335-2-113:2023/oprAB:2026. Understanding these relationships helps ensure you are using the most current and applicable version of the standard.

SIST EN IEC 60335-2-113:2023/oprA1:2026 is associated with the following European legislation: EU Directives/Regulations: 2014/35/EU; Standardization Mandates: M/511. When a standard is cited in the Official Journal of the European Union, products manufactured in conformity with it benefit from a presumption of conformity with the essential requirements of the corresponding EU directive or regulation.
